Shut down the Main Waterline Valve
The first thing to do? Close the shut-off shutoff. Look for the regional shut-off shutoff to shut off the water in one details location just. If you do not know where the localized shut-off valve is, go with the major water line shutoff and transform it off. This action will certainly remove the water quickly in your whole home. Normally, the primary shutoff is located outside the residence beside the water meter. If it's not there, you can also locate it in 2 areas: in the cellar at eye degree or the first floor on the ground. Commonly, contractors placed the shut-off valve generally ground level restroom or ideal alongside it.

What To Do When A Water Pipe Bursts In Your Apartment
Identify The Leak Source
Given how many appliances and water fixtures the average apartment or home has, it s not always easy to know right away where the water is coming from. Start looking around and see if you can discover it.
Check under sinks, behind appliances, and look at ceilings if you have a multi-story home. If you notice that water is pooling from a particular part of the ceiling, take note of its location as you walk upstairs to investigate. You can then turn off the water supply valve while you make your plan of attack.
Notify Neighbors and the Landlord
Apartment living can be incredibly convenient, but only when a pipe hasn t burst in your apartment. Sometimes, your burst pipe can affect your neighbors. If that s the case, contact each of the neighbors affected to alert them to the problem.
If you rent your apartment, contact your landlord right away.
You can then ask for an ETA on having someone come out to fix the pipe and repair the damage. However, if you re the homeowner, it s up to you to phone a water damage company or plumber who can manage both the problem and subsequent damage
Collect Your Belongings
Depending on the scale of the damage, you may need to remove all your possessions from the apartment and put them into storage while the plumbing is fixed and your apartment is repaired.
In the meantime, make sure all electronics are away from the water and put anything porous like soft furnishings and clothing into plastic containers or bags.
Take Note Of The Damage
As shocked as you might be to come home and find your apartment dripping wet, it s essential to keep a clear head. Take photos and video footage with timestamps of all areas of your home affected by the water.
Be sure to capture footage of damaged walls, ceilings, and flooring, not to mention soggy furniture and possessions that may need to be replaced. Keep all your evidence in one place, so it s easy to find should you need to make an insurance claim.
